Peer reviewedKatz, Albert N. – Teaching of Psychology, 1978
Suggests use of the planarian D. Dorotocephala, an animal 20 mm in size, in order to provide inexpensive lab experiences for students in large introductory psychology courses. The animal can be used to study perception, memory, behavior modification, and group processes. (Author/AV)

Peer reviewedDavis, Leslie N.; And Others – Journal of Chemical Education, 1973
Discusses a laboratory course with computer-assisted instruction which emphasizes uses of simulated data, students' improvement of experiments, and presentation of a tutorial self-test mode. Indicates that students' enthusiasm is mostly due to computer's potential for in-depth interactivity and conformity to real-life situations. (CC)

Peer reviewedBrandt, D.; And Others – Physics Education, 1974
Discusses the use of programmed scripts, textbooks, films, and cassette tapes to conduct a self-instruction laboratory course. Indicates the presence of marked positive effects on the development of the students' ability to plan their own experiments. (CC)
